Chrysler offered either a six-speed manual or five-speed automatic transmission, both borrowed from theyou guessed itSLK320. Styling cues like the rakish fastback profile, distinctive character lines on the hood, and boat-tail rear made it onto the production Crossfire, but the more menacing headlights and front grille as well as the retro-cool split windshield didnt make the cut. The Crossfire was created during the now-terminated merger between German giant Daimler AG and the Chrysler Corporation. The vast majority of these were sold in the USA, but some made their way over to Europe. The Crossfire was produced by DaimlerChrysler (the two companies have since split), and was built by Karmann at their facility in Osnabrck, Germany. Developed during the union of Daimler and Chrysler, the two-seater is based on the Mercedes-Benz R170 platform which shares 80% of its components with the first generation SLK. With the SLK320's 3.2-liter V6 producing 215 hp and 229 lb-ft of torque powering the 3,100 lbs Crossfire, acceleration was adequate if not authoritative. Given the fact that the Crossfire was produced under Daimler by Karmann, it received the Mercedes-Benz 3.2-liter M112 E32 V6.
